High Holiday Schedule for Teens and Families with Children
High Holiday Services for Teens and Families with Children
Family Service
A family friendly junior congregation service targeting school-aged children (5-10 years old) will be led by a Family Educator on the first day of Rosh Hashanah and on Yom Kippur morning in our school wing.
The presence of a guardian is required for children under age 5.
Junior Congregation will commence with the start of the Torah Service in the main service – about 10:15 am - and is expected to run for approximately 1 hour.

Teen Discussions
Teen Discussions will be held at 11am on Rosh Hashanah Day 1 and on Yom Kippur in the Library.
